Output 6aa60fc20c129f761d3e2c149fe82d103f19ae8bbf0a97cbf80e3ceb0d81fb19:0

value
23943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f455d59e3a119d3ef122e1e91092a88f6317676 OP_EQUALVERIFY OP_CHECKSIG
address
1CbwuuNp4zoDaSQJwV3Z6DgKCGK3kTWpCw
transaction
6aa60fc20c129f761d3e2c149fe82d103f19ae8bbf0a97cbf80e3ceb0d81fb19
spent
true